    The only way to truly appreciate the magnificent scenery of Ha Long Bay is by scenic flight. Admire the stunning seascapes made up of nearly 2,000 limestone islands rising from the emerald green waters, strewn over an area of nearly 2,000 square kilometers. Taking off and landing on the water at Tuan Chau Marina, our 25-minute scenic flight showcases the highlights of the UNESCO World Heritage Site of Ha Long Bay, offering a completely different perspective than from a cruise ship. From the air, the many islands appear like mountain ranges, the embodiment of "Ha Long", meaning "descending dragon".

    Sung Sot Cave

    As the largest and most stunning limestone cave in Halong Bay, Sung Sot Cave has captured the hearts of numerous domestic and foreign travelers with its sparkling stalactites and attractive rock formations. During your travel journey to Ha Long, visiting Sung Sot Cave (Surprise Cave Vietnam) should be one of the top activities on your bucket list. Situated in a limestone mountain with an extremely developed karst terrain, the cave features two big chambers with a wealth of stalagmites of various shapes.     Hang Luon Cave

    Luon Cave is considered as one of the most ideal places in Halong Bay for kayaking. If you have a great passion for kayaking, you should not miss Luon Cave. In addition to kayaking, rowing is another great option if you want to explore Luon Cave. Sitting on a bamboo boat rowed by a local, visitors can see a variety of plants such as ferns, cycads, Benjamin’s fig trees, and many beautiful orchids.     Ti Top Island

    Titop Beach is not so big, but it is peaceful and clean. Thanks to the daily tidal wave rise, the sand is “washed” to white, lying next to nice emerald green seawater. Swimming here is one of the most significant activities in Halong Bay. Nowadays, there is a bar at the beach, with swimsuit rental services, a swimming float, and a fresh-water bath.
